Daily Getaways Sale Returns April 27, 2020 (Preview April 20)

[UPDATE: this sale has been postponed] Every year the U.S. Travel Association holds a big sale of various loyalty point packages, hotel stays, theme park tickets etc. There are usually some great bargains available and Canadian residents are eligible to make purchases. I see on the Daily Getaways website they’ve announced the next sale will begin April 27, 2020 with a preview to be released on April 20th.

The Daily Getaways sale spans several weeks. A few of the offerings are typically very popular and will sell out quickly so it’s a good idea to check the preview so you’re ready to go when a deal that interests you goes live. You can also sign up for daily reminder emails.

You may read comments online about how the promotion was much better years ago. However, back then it was not open to Canadian residents so at least we’re now able to access the offers.

Choice Privileges points have been a mainstay of the Daily Getaways promo so presumably they will return. In the past, prices have been very reasonable and the packages disappear fast. We’ve purchased Choice points the last two years without difficulty but the year before that, they were gone within seconds.

I’ve tried for a Loews Royal Pacific hotel stay at Universal Orlando as well but those have been extremely limited in number and sell out almost instantaneously.

I’m looking forward to seeing if there any interesting new travel deals this time around. It’s great to see the sale returning next month. It’s a little flash of positivity amid the gloom that currently abounds in the world of travel as a result of COVID-19 concerns.

    This is most interesting. I’ve heard tell of this website but I was always afraid it wasn’t legitimate. Great to know it’s for real. Does the sale go live at midnight or at a specific time in the morning?

      Last year each day’s sale went live at 2 pm Atlantic. If it’s a really popular item, you need to be refreshing the page exactly on the hour and even then you might lose out. Less enticing deals might remain available for the remainder of the promo period. Once you have the package in your “cart” you then have a reasonable number of minutes to complete the purchase.
